KNX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2019 in Review
344 of the 4,620 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Knight Transportation (KNX) for Q1 2019, worth a combined $4.73B — up 32% from $3.59B a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 72 funds opened new KNX positions and 41 closed out — a net gain of 31 holders — while 104 added to existing stakes and 125 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Fidelity Investments, adding an estimated $126M. The largest seller was Teachers Advisors, cutting an estimated $38.3M.
